Symposium overview

AMOLF will host its annual Sustainable Energy Materials Symposium on Friday, June 19th, 2026, in Amsterdam, this year centered on the theme “Light for driving and monitoring chemical reactions.” The symposium will bring together the Dutch sustainable energy community to highlight recent advances in photocatalysis and related fields, spanning topics from single-particle photocatalytic and optical studies to operando thermometry and reaction monitoring of plasmonic photocatalysis.
